Default F2 code
Brand: Kenmore
Model Number: 911.4658810
Age: More than 10 years

Having F2 code coming on sometimes. Range is working fine. Any insights to what could be the cause? Also, could you list the codes for this range? thanks

replace the sensor. Open your oven door, and look at the top left or top right, and you will see a a thin shaft. That's the sensor. Take the 2 screws out and pull it through. Sometimes it gets stuck in the back, and you have to take off the back panel to unhook it. Then reinstall. The part # is WB21X5301.
